Frontline Combination CAR-T Cell Therapy for Multiple Myeloma or Plasmacytoma

Recruiting now · Phase 1/Phase 2

Conditions studied: Multiple Myeloma, Plasmacytoma

In brief

The aim of this clinical trial is to assess the feasibility, safety, and efficacy of CAR-T cell therapy targeting multiple cancer cell antigens in high-risk multiple myeloma or plasmacytoma as part of a frontline treatment regimen for patients. Another goal of the study is to learn more about the persistence and function of these CAR-T cells in the body.
